What You'll Do
As a Trust & Estate Manager, you'll play a key role in managing our trust, estate, gift, and high-net-worth individual client relationships. Responsibilities will include:
- Manage and review trust, estate, gift, and individual income tax returns, including Forms 1041, 706, 709, and complex 1040s.
- Oversee trust and estate engagements from planning through preparation, review, and completion.
- Work directly with high-net-worth individuals, families, fiduciaries, executors, trustees, attorneys, and financial advisors.
- Assist clients with estate and gift tax planning, trust taxation, wealth transfer strategies, and related compliance matters.
- Research complex trust and estate tax issues and provide practical recommendations to clients.
- Identify planning opportunities and proactively advise clients on potential tax implications.
- Review work prepared by staff and provide technical guidance and feedback.
- Supervise, mentor, and develop associates and senior-level team members.
- Stay current on changes to federal and state trust, estate, and gift tax laws and help educate the broader team.
- Build long-term client relationships by serving as a responsive and knowledgeable point of contact.
- Collaborate with partners and other professionals across the firm to deliver comprehensive solutions.
